阿里云轻量服务器不提供数据库吗?

阿里云轻量服务器不提供数据库吗?答案与解决方案全解析

结论先行阿里云轻量应用服务器(Lighthouse)本身不预装数据库服务,但用户可通过三种方式实现数据库部署:① 手动安装数据库软件;② 购买阿里云独立数据库产品(如RDS);③ 使用容器化方案快速搭建。核心矛盾在于轻量服务器的定位是"开箱即用的基础计算资源"而非全托管服务,数据库管理需用户自行承担运维责任。


一、轻量服务器的产品定位与数据库服务现状

  1. 资源包特性:轻量服务器主打"轻量化、低成本"(最低24元/月),套餐包含CPU、内存、SSD硬盘和流量包,未将数据库作为预装组件。其设计初衷是满足建站、测试、小程序等轻量场景,与ECS云服务器形成差异化竞争。
  2. 官方说明验证:阿里云文档明确提示:"轻量应用服务器默认不安装数据库,若需使用MySQL等数据库,需通过应用镜像或自行安装"。例如选择"WordPress镜像"时会自动部署MySQL,但此为特定场景的集成方案。
  3. 与RDS的定位区隔:阿里云数据库RDS提供99.95%可用性保障、自动备份等企业级功能,轻量服务器+自建数据库的方案在稳定性与维护成本上存在明显差距,适合非核心业务场景。

二、三种主流数据库部署方案对比(以MySQL为例)

方案 实施难度 成本(月) 运维要求 适用场景
手动安装 ★★★☆☆ 0元 需定期更新补丁 开发测试、个人博客
使用RDS ★☆☆☆☆ 80元起 阿里云全托管 电商、企业官网等生产环境
Docker容器化部署 ★★☆☆☆ 0元 需基础运维知识 快速部署、微服务架构

关键数据

  • 自建数据库需预留至少1GB内存(MySQL基础运行消耗约512MB)
  • RDS基础版价格是轻量服务器的3倍,但节省日均1小时运维时间成本
  • 2023年云数据库故障统计显示,自建数据库的宕机概率是托管服务的4.2倍

三、操作指南:轻量服务器部署MySQL全流程(精简版)

  1. 连接服务器
    ssh root@your_server_ip
  2. 安装MySQL(以Ubuntu为例)
    sudo apt update && sudo apt install mysql-server
    sudo mysql_secure_installation
  3. 配置远程访问
    CREATE USER 'remote_user'@'%' IDENTIFIED BY 'StrongPassword!';
    GRANT ALL PRIVILEGES ON *.* TO 'remote_user'@'%';
  4. 防火墙设置
    在轻量服务器控制台开放3306端口

注意事项

  • 必须定期执行mysqldump备份数据
  • 建议安装Fail2ban防止暴力破解
  • 内存小于2GB时需优化my.cnf配置

四、深度建议:什么情况下该选择RDS?

当出现以下特征时,强烈建议使用专业数据库服务

  • 业务涉及交易支付等核心系统
  • 日均访问量超过5000次
  • 缺乏专职运维团队
  • 需要满足等保三级等合规要求

典型案例:某跨境电商初创公司使用轻量服务器自建数据库,在促销期间因连接数暴增导致数据丢失,切换RDS后故障率下降76%。


结语

轻量服务器不提供数据库的本质,反映的是云计算领域"分层解耦"的设计哲学。用户应根据业务阶段灵活选择:测试环境可采用"轻量服务器+Docker"快速搭建,生产环境则建议通过VPC专有网络连接RDS。技术决策的本质,永远是在控制成本与保障稳定性之间寻找最佳平衡点

未经允许不得转载:ECLOUD博客 » 阿里云轻量服务器不提供数据库吗?